MN | We ran a set for the first time this year. We did several test strips to see if there is a benefit from late season N. We have been abnormally wet this year so if the nitrogen did move lower in the profile this late application should help.
We replaced our 60' side dress bar with the Y-Drops, 18 drops on 60" spacing (90' STS 12) and they work as advertised, I personally don't think having one in every row is necessary. They work best when corn is around waist high or taller.
I would recommend spending a few extra bucks and get the vari target nozzles, very unhappy with the Greenleaf nozzles that come from 360. I also need to figure out how to get them to stop leaking when turning on headlands.
